Four Drones, 940 gm heroin seized in Punjab in 24 hours

Drone and heroin confiscated by the BSF in Amritsar and Tarn Taran areas on Saturday.

The BSF confiscated four drones and contraband in Amritsar, Tarn Taran and Pathankot border areas on Saturday. Following inputs by village defence committee members, the BSF seized two drones and a packet of heroin from Amritsar. The BSF authorities said a China-made DJI Mavic 3 Classic drone and a packet containing 470 gm heroin were found in a field across the border security fence at Mullakot village here. A crashed drone was found on the rooftop a BSF building at Attari.

In a joint operation with the police, the BSF confiscated a DJI Mavic 3 Classic drone along with a packet containing 500 gm heroin during a search operation at Makhanpur village in Pathankot. Another drone was seized from a field at Kalash village in Tarn Taran.
